Gentoo Archives: gentoo-commits

From: "Maciej Barć" <xgqt@××××××.net>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/proj/guru:dev commit in: dev-scheme/guile-gi/
Date: Thu, 07 Oct 2021 21:09:11
Message-Id: 1633640868.7f2601de6f7ca636c1884800cc9dafa537eb29db.xgqt@gentoo
1 commit: 7f2601de6f7ca636c1884800cc9dafa537eb29db
2 Author: Maciej Barć <xgqt <AT> riseup <DOT> net>
3 AuthorDate: Thu Oct 7 21:04:41 2021 +0000
4 Commit: Maciej Barć <xgqt <AT> riseup <DOT> net>
5 CommitDate: Thu Oct 7 21:07:48 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=7f2601de
7
8 dev-scheme/guile-gi: fix QA issues
9
10 Closes: https://bugs.gentoo.org/816528
11 Package-Manager: Portage-3.0.20, Repoman-3.0.3
12 Signed-off-by: Maciej Barć <xgqt <AT> riseup.net>
13
14 dev-scheme/guile-gi/guile-gi-0.3.1.ebuild | 8 ++++----
15 dev-scheme/guile-gi/guile-gi-9999.ebuild | 8 ++++----
16 2 files changed, 8 insertions(+), 8 deletions(-)
17
18 diff --git a/dev-scheme/guile-gi/guile-gi-0.3.1.ebuild b/dev-scheme/guile-gi/guile-gi-0.3.1.ebuild
19 index 0d6e4133b..068ae4404 100644
20 --- a/dev-scheme/guile-gi/guile-gi-0.3.1.ebuild
21 +++ b/dev-scheme/guile-gi/guile-gi-0.3.1.ebuild
22 @@ -15,7 +15,7 @@ else
23 fi
24
25 # Tests fail
26 -RESTRICT="strip test"
27 +RESTRICT="test"
28 LICENSE="GPL-3"
29 SLOT="0"
30
31 @@ -31,7 +31,8 @@ RDEPEND="${DEPEND}"
32
33 # guile generates ELF files without use of C or machine code
34 # It's a portage's false positive. bug #677600
35 -QA_FLAGS_IGNORED=".*[.]go"
36 +QA_FLAGS_IGNORED='.*[.]go'
37 +QA_PREBUILT='.*[.]go'
38
39 src_prepare() {
40 default
41 @@ -61,6 +62,5 @@ src_configure() {
42 src_install() {
43 default
44
45 - mv "${D}/usr/share/doc/${PN}"/* "${D}/usr/share/doc/${PF}" || die
46 - rm -r "${D}/usr/share/doc/${PN}" || die
47 + mv "${D}/usr/share/doc/${PN}" "${D}/usr/share/doc/${PF}" || die
48 }
49
50 diff --git a/dev-scheme/guile-gi/guile-gi-9999.ebuild b/dev-scheme/guile-gi/guile-gi-9999.ebuild
51 index 0d6e4133b..068ae4404 100644
52 --- a/dev-scheme/guile-gi/guile-gi-9999.ebuild
53 +++ b/dev-scheme/guile-gi/guile-gi-9999.ebuild
54 @@ -15,7 +15,7 @@ else
55 fi
56
57 # Tests fail
58 -RESTRICT="strip test"
59 +RESTRICT="test"
60 LICENSE="GPL-3"
61 SLOT="0"
62
63 @@ -31,7 +31,8 @@ RDEPEND="${DEPEND}"
64
65 # guile generates ELF files without use of C or machine code
66 # It's a portage's false positive. bug #677600
67 -QA_FLAGS_IGNORED=".*[.]go"
68 +QA_FLAGS_IGNORED='.*[.]go'
69 +QA_PREBUILT='.*[.]go'
70
71 src_prepare() {
72 default
73 @@ -61,6 +62,5 @@ src_configure() {
74 src_install() {
75 default
76
77 - mv "${D}/usr/share/doc/${PN}"/* "${D}/usr/share/doc/${PF}" || die
78 - rm -r "${D}/usr/share/doc/${PN}" || die
79 + mv "${D}/usr/share/doc/${PN}" "${D}/usr/share/doc/${PF}" || die
80 }